I moved into a rental house while my new house is being built. I sent in the ATF Form 530038 to change the address on my C&R license to the rental house (I was told that was the form to use.) I got my application back today with a notation that I have to answer questions 22, 23 and 24 on the application. When I filled it out, I marked all three of those questions "N/A - licensed collector", since all three of them relate to operation of a business, which is something I can't do.

Now, how do I answer these questions? Just answer all three of them NO? I tried to call the National Licensing Center today, but no one was there or the phone just rang (very frustrating experience!)

Check 'no' for all of them. I checked 'no' when I changed addresses a while back and didn't have any problems at all.

For further reference, I e-mailed them about just which sections a collector is supposed to fill out on the Amended License Application. Here is the response:

Thank you for contacting the ATF's National Licensing Center (NLC Atlanta)
with your e-mail inquiry.

As a collector you are required to complete all items on ATF Form 5300.38,
except: 4,14,15,16 and 17.
